Користувальницькькі налаштування

Налаштування сайту


openpayz

Розбіжності

Тут показані розбіжності між вибраною ревізією та поточною версією сторінки.

Посилання на цей список змін

Порівняння попередніх версій Попередня ревізія
Наступна ревізія
Попередня ревізія
openpayz [2024/10/24 12:54]
bobr [Чим приймаються оплати?]
openpayz [2025/03/11 19:14] (поточний)
nightfly [Режим високої продуктивності]
Рядок 16: Рядок 16:
 | [[http://24nonstop.com.ua/|24NonStop]] | Термінали | 24nonstop | | [[http://24nonstop.com.ua/|24NonStop]] | Термінали | 24nonstop |
 | [[http://24nonstop.com.ua/|МобиАЗС]] | Термінали | 24nonstop|  | [[http://24nonstop.com.ua/|МобиАЗС]] | Термінали | 24nonstop| 
-| [[https://privatbank.ua|Приватбанк]] | Приват24\\ Термінали\\ | privatx, privatx_strict, privatmulti, privatmultifa, [[openpayz#privat_multiserv|privat_multiserv]] |+| [[https://privatbank.ua|Приватбанк]] | Приват24\\ Термінали\\ | privatx, privatx_strict, privatmulti, privatmultifa, [[openpayz#privat_multiserv|privat_multiserv]], PrivatGoose |
 | [[https://liqpay.ua/|LiqPay]] | VISA\\ MasterCard | liqpay |  | [[https://liqpay.ua/|LiqPay]] | VISA\\ MasterCard | liqpay | 
 | [[https://www.ibox.ua/|iBox]] | Термінали | ibox, iboxmulti |  | [[https://www.ibox.ua/|iBox]] | Термінали | ibox, iboxmulti | 
Рядок 34: Рядок 34:
 | [[http://www.comepay.ru/|Comepay]] | Термінали | comepay | | [[http://www.comepay.ru/|Comepay]] | Термінали | comepay |
 | [[http://city-pay.com.ua/|City-Pay]] | Термінали | citypay | | [[http://city-pay.com.ua/|City-Pay]] | Термінали | citypay |
-| [[https://www.city24.ua|City24]] | Термінали | city24 city24_multi |+| [[https://www.city24.ua|City24]] | Термінали | city24 city24_multi City24Goose |
 | [[https://www.copayco.com/ru/|CoPAYCo]] | VISA\\ MasterCard\\ Укрексимбанк\\ Кредитпромбанк\\  НСМЭП\\ WebMoney | copayco | | [[https://www.copayco.com/ru/|CoPAYCo]] | VISA\\ MasterCard\\ Укрексимбанк\\ Кредитпромбанк\\  НСМЭП\\ WebMoney | copayco |
 | [[http://www.pay-logic.ru/|Paylogic / ОСМП]] | Термінали | osmp |  | [[http://www.pay-logic.ru/|Paylogic / ОСМП]] | Термінали | osmp | 
Рядок 48: Рядок 48:
 | [[https://developer.help.paycom.uz/ru/nastroyka-vzaimodeystviya|PaymeUZ]] | кредитки\\ Android APP | payme_uz / mypaymeuz | | [[https://developer.help.paycom.uz/ru/nastroyka-vzaimodeystviya|PaymeUZ]] | кредитки\\ Android APP | payme_uz / mypaymeuz |
 | [[https://globalmoney.ua/|GlobalMoney]] | Термінали | globalmoney | | [[https://globalmoney.ua/|GlobalMoney]] | Термінали | globalmoney |
-| [[https://platon.ua/|Platon]] | Google Pay\\ Apple Pay\\ Приват24\\ Privat Pay\\ Masterpass\\ VisaCheckout\\ Visa\\ Mastercard\\ Простір | platon |+| [[https://platon.ua/|Platon]] | Google Pay\\ Apple Pay\\ Приват24\\ Privat Pay\\ Masterpass\\ VisaCheckout\\ Visa\\ Mastercard\\ Простір | platon platonGoose 
 | Platonmobile | Google Pay\\ Apple Pay\\ Visa\\ Mastercard | [[openpayz#platonmobile|platonmobile]] | | Platonmobile | Google Pay\\ Apple Pay\\ Visa\\ Mastercard | [[openpayz#platonmobile|platonmobile]] |
 | [[https://providex.net/uk/|Providex]] | Google Pay\\ Apple Pay\\ Visa\\ Mastercard | [[openpayz#providex|providex]] / providex | | [[https://providex.net/uk/|Providex]] | Google Pay\\ Apple Pay\\ Visa\\ Mastercard | [[openpayz#providex|providex]] / providex |
Рядок 141: Рядок 141:
 </code> </code>
  
-вся обробка транзакцій перестає здійснюватися вбудованими у фронтенди викликами op_ProcessHandlers і повинна бути винесена в окремий воркер op_WorkerPaymentsProceed, що періодично викликається. Викликатися він може, наприклад із "crontab -e" якось так:+вся обробка транзакцій перестає здійснюватися вбудованими у фронтенди викликами op_ProcessHandlers і повинна бути винесена в окремий воркер **op_WorkerPaymentsProceed** або **opprocessing**, що періодично викликається. Викликатися він може, наприклад із "crontab -e" 
  
 +якось так (до релізу Ubilling 1.5.3, рахується застарілим):
 <code bash> <code bash>
 */2 * * * * /usr/local/bin/php /usr/local/www/apache24/data/openpayz/libs/op_WorkerPaymentsProceed.php */2 * * * * /usr/local/bin/php /usr/local/www/apache24/data/openpayz/libs/op_WorkerPaymentsProceed.php
 </code> </code>
 +
 +чи ось так, після Ubilling 1.5.3 (рекомендовано)
 +<code bash>
 +*/2 * * * *     /bin/ubapi "opprocessing"
 +</code>
 +
 +Варіант виклику обробки транзакцій за допомогою виклику opprocessing з [[remoteapi|RemoteAPI]] також потребує ввімкнення опції OPENPAYZ_HIGHLOAD_ENABLE в [[alteriniconf|alter.ini]]:
 +
 +<file ini alter.ini>
 +OPENPAYZ_HIGHLOAD_ENABLE=1
 +</file>
 +
 +Обробка виклику opprocessing відбувається в рамках унікального процесу OP_PROCESSING [[stardust|StarDust]], що можна перевірити за допомогою модулю "Фонові процеси". Зрозуміло, що в crontab може існувати тільки один з цих викликів. В ідеалі - opprocessing.
  
 Слід також зауважити, що експлуатація OpenPayz з вимкненою опцією OP_HIGHLOAD_ENABLE у реальному світі та на продакшні вкрай не рекомендується. Відключати його має сенс лише при тестуванні та запуску нових фронтендів платіжних систем. В іншому випадку, ви можете банально напоротись на дублікати оплат, та інші в цілому очікувані ефекти. Слід також зауважити, що експлуатація OpenPayz з вимкненою опцією OP_HIGHLOAD_ENABLE у реальному світі та на продакшні вкрай не рекомендується. Відключати його має сенс лише при тестуванні та запуску нових фронтендів платіжних систем. В іншому випадку, ви можете банально напоротись на дублікати оплат, та інші в цілому очікувані ефекти.
openpayz.1729763695.txt.gz · Востаннє змінено: 2024/10/24 12:54 повз bobr